DEFINITION

Classification: 241/290

(under subclass 286) Apparatus in which the normally stationary comminuting element is so connected to the frame as to be capable of yielding movement upon the application of abnormal force.

(1) Note. The mounting must be such as will return the comminuting element to its original position upon the cessation of the abnormal force.

SEE OR SEARCH THIS CLASS, SUBCLASS:

32, for overload release devices for supporting comminuting elements for yielding movement but which are not adapted to return the element to its original position upon cessation of the force.

289, for pivotally mounted yielding comminuting elements.
